The Pederson Vaginal Speculum Extra Large is a high-quality gynecological surgical instrument designed to provide dependable vaginal retraction and superior visualization during examinations and operative procedures. Its extra-large, narrow blade profile is specifically engineered to gently separate the vaginal walls while maintaining patient comfort, making it an excellent choice for patients who require greater reach and exposure than standard Pederson speculums. The instrument allows healthcare professionals to obtain a clear view of the cervix and vaginal canal for accurate diagnosis and treatment.
